In this one-hour course, the participant will evaluate the contributions of building products to successful outcomes of green building projects. Explore the LEED v4 Rating Systems from the manufacturer’s perspective to gain critical insight when it comes to product selection and what to expect from “LEED-savvy” manufacturers. Conclude with a review of the literature and tools that manufacturers can utilize to increase their chances of being selected for use in green buildings.
- Describe the evolving role of product manufacturers in supporting LEED projects
- List the primary LEED v4 credits associated with building products
- Avoid common pitfalls and misstatements when communicating the sustainability benefits of building products
- Assess current and future opportunities to increase product contributions toward LEED certification
